akka ’ 目录归档

AKKA文档(java版)——用例与部署场景

原文:http://doc.akka.io/docs/akka/2.3.6/intro/deployment-scenarios.html 译者:吴京润

我如何使用与部署akka?

有两种不同的使用akka的方式:

  • 作为一个库:作为一个web应用的类路径下的普通JAR使用,将它放在WEB-INF/lib。
  • 在一上主类中通过实例化ActorSystem作为一个独立的应用运行,或使用微内核 (Scala) /(Java)

将akka作为一个库使用

如果你在构建一个web应用,这可能就是你想要的。在库模式下,通过向模块栈添加越来越多的模块有许多种使用akka的方式。

将akka作为独立的微内核使用

akka还可以作为一个独立的微内核运行。更多信息见微内核 (Scala) / (Java) 

AKKA文档(java版)——hello world

原文:http://doc.akka.io/docs/akka/2.3.6/java/hello-world.html 译者:吴京润

基于actor在控制台打印这一知名问候的困难在Typesafe Activator教程中名为Akka Main in Java项目中已有介绍。

本教程说明了通用启动器类akka.Main,只接收一个命令行参数:应用的主actor类名。这个main方法将为运行actor创建基础设施,用来启动指定的主actor以及在主actor终止时为关闭整个应用做出安排

Typesafe Activator中有相同问题域的另一个名为Hello Akka!的教程讲述了更深入的akka基础知识。

AKKA文档(java版)——准备开始

原文:http://doc.akka.io/docs/akka/2.3.6/intro/getting-started.html  译者:吴京润

预备知识

AKKA要求你的计算机已经安装了Java1.6或更高版本。

入门指南与模板项目

学习AKKA的最好方式是下载Typesafe Activator并尝试一个AKKA模板项目。

下载

有许多种下载AKKA的方式。你可以把它当作Typesafe平台的一部分下载(就像上面描述的)。还可以下载完全发布版,它包含微内核以及所有模块。或者使用像Maven或SBT这样的构建工具从AKKA Maven仓库下载依赖。 阅读全文

AKKA文档(java版)

目前我正在翻译AKKA官网文档。翻译:吴京润

译者注:本人正在翻译AKKA官网文档,本篇是文档第一章,欢迎有兴趣的同学加入一起翻译。

阅读全文

AKKA文档(java版)——什么是AKKA?

原文:http://doc.akka.io/docs/akka/2.3.6/intro/what-is-akka.htmll  译者:吴京润

可扩展的实时事务处理

我们相信编写并发、容错、可扩展的应用相当的困难。盖因大多数时候我们一直在使用错误的工具和错误的抽象等级。AKKA就是为了改变这一切的。我们利用角色模型提升了抽象等级,并且提供了一个用来构建可扩展的、弹性的以及响应式应用的更好的平台——更多信息请见Reactive Manifesto。对于容错机制我们采用“让它崩溃”模型,这一模型已在电信行业取得了巨大的成功,旨在构建自我修复与永不停机的系统。角色还提供了透明的分布式抽象以及真正的可扩展且容错应用的基础。

AKKA是开源的,并遵守Apache2许可。

http://akka.io/downloads下载。

请注意所有代码样例的编译,因此如果你想直接访问这些源码,可以去github上访问AKKA文档子项目:JavaScala阅读全文

return top